Detached, self-catering Holiday Cottage, near Aberlour, Banffshire, Scotland. Part of the Ballindalloch Castle Estate and set within the cobbled courtyard of a nearby lodge, Pitchroy Cottage is ideally situated for exploring this beautiful area of Scotland. There are many local walks and the Ballindalloch Castle Golf Course is a sure winner with golfing enthusiasts. Visitors enjoy complimentary entry to the castle and gardens during their stay. For whisky lovers, many of the famous distilleries can be found locally and tours are often available. This delightful cottage, refurbished and extended in 2006, is situated in the grounds of a beautiful Victorian lodge that was at one time home to Captain W. E. Johns, the author of the Biggles books. Spacious living room. Fitted kitchen/dining room. Double bedroom with en-suite bathroom/W.C. Twin-bedded room. Bathroom/W.C.
